/*
 * MAX_BULK_EDIT_ROWS caps how many rows the Ledgerbird admin
 * table will mutate in a single bulk-edit request. New folks:
 * raising this past the tested ceiling caused lock contention
 * during the Varnwood incident, so change it only with a load
 * test attached. The validated build for the current cap is
 * identified by the token below.
 */

session token of tajef-bageg = htk21_5d90d574934f3ccae6437

## Step 3: SQL lint gate

Before cutting a Burrowbase release, the lint job checks every SQL file: uppercase keywords, no SELECT *, and explicit column lists on inserts. Don't skip it — the migration runner refuses unlinted files. If lint passes, the pipeline builds the signed migration bundle automatically. Sign the bundle with the key below.

rollout seal: bky4_x7Gc

## Env Vars: FD Hunt on Corvette-Nine

While chasing leaked file descriptors in the Tallowmere proxy, we added FD_TRACE=1 to staging. It logs every open/close pair, which is how we caught the unclosed pipe in the Quibler module. Tracing uploads go to the internal sink, so put the sink credential right after this comment.

env line for fafof-fahag: LEDGER_TOKEN5=f8790

## Handover: EXIF scrubbing on Pictorella uploads

For the weekly sync — handing this off from me to Dara. The Pictorella upload pipeline now strips EXIF metadata (GPS, device info, timestamps) before anything hits storage. Scrubbing runs in the ingest worker, not the CDN layer, so don't panic if cached originals from before the cutover still carry metadata; the backfill job is chewing through those. One gotcha: HEIC files route through a separate scrubber. Current scrubber settings are as follows.

settings of fawip-yadug:
[druath]
port = 3000
region = north-4
host = druath.qirvanworks.corp
timeout_ms = 1500
retries = 1